Work on the 27th season of the crime thriller will begin in early … http://www.maphill.com/united-kingdom/england/west-midlands/birmingham/birmingham/detailed-maps/terrain-map/ WebBirmingham, in the West Midlands, is Britain 's second-largest city. Known in the Victorian era as the "City of a Thousand Trades" and the "Workshop of the World", Brum, as locals call the city, is enjoying a 21st-century resurgence as a great shopping and cultural destination. WebMidlands, region of central England, commonly subdivided into the East and the West Midlands. The East Midlands includes the historic and geographic counties of Lincolnshire, Northamptonshire, Derbyshire, … The West Midlands is a landlocked county that borders the counties of Warwickshire to the east, Worcestershire to the south, and Staffordshire to the north and west. The West Midlands County is one of the most heavily urbanised counties in the UK. Birmingham, Wolverhampton, the Black Country and Solihull together form the third …

A serving West Mercia Police officer has died after collasping while on duty. PC Andy Boardman, who was 43, was taken ill while working in Broseley, Shropshire, yesterday afternoon (Tuesday 11 April). He joined West Mercia Police in 2015, having started his policing career in 2007 with West Midlands …
